What is responsible for termination of transcription in eukaryotic protein-coding genes?
kupik [55]

Answer:

<h2>A polyadenylation signal or poly(A) </h2>

Explanation:

Termination. In eukaryotes, transcription is terminated differently for the all 3 different RNA polymerases. Transcription is terminated by two elements: i) a poly(A) signal and ii) a downstream terminator sequence.

In eukaryotic protein-encoding genes, the cleavage site in the RNA occurs between an upstream( the sequence before the cleavage site) AAUAAA  and a downstream GU-rich, separated by approx 40-60 nucleotides. After they both have been transcribed, a protein knows as CPSF  and another protein called CstF( in humans)  helps in termination.

Explanation:

 In the trophic web occurs energy transference through organisms occupying different levels in the chain. Each level feeds on the preceding one and becomes food for the next one. The first link is occupied by autotroph organisms, which are the producer. The following links are the consumers: herbivores are primary consumers and feed on producers. Carnivores are secondary consumers and feed on herbivores, and so on. The last links are the decomposers, microorganisms that act on dead animals degrading organic matter.  

Every link has an effect on the superior links and the immediately anterior link, meaning that whenever one of the links changes, the other ones will be affected.  

Autotrophs or producers synthesize inorganic substances, such as light, and turn them into organic matter according to their own needs. These organisms are photoautotrophs, such as plants, or chemoautotrophs. They occur at the first trophic level.

Heterotrophs are those incapable of producing their own organic matter, so they feed on producers, depending on them to get proteins and energy. In the trophic chain, heterotrophic organisms occupy the first, second, or third consumer level, after producers. These animals can be herbivorous, carnivorous,  omnivorous, hematophagous, ichthyophagous, and etcetera. All of them depend on autotrophic organisms.

In the particular case of herbivores, they occur at the second throphic level feeding on producers and being eaten by carnivores.

In general, most trophic chains are composed of 4 or 5 levels, depending on the number of consumers present, and the energy transference between levels.
